At its core, this supplement combines hydrolyzed collagen peptides with a multivitamin and mineral blend. The collagen peptide component is the key functional protein, typically sourced from fish or bovine raw materials, broken down through enzymatic hydrolysis into smaller peptide chains (molecular weight 2,000–5,000 Da). This process makes the collagen highly soluble and bioavailable. For B2B buyers, the critical takeaway is that the collagen peptide must meet specific quality markers: high protein content (≥90%), low odor, and consistent solubility. The multivitamin and mineral portion adds complexity, but the collagen peptide remains the primary active for skin, joint, and connective tissue support.
The working principle is straightforward. Native collagen is a large, triple-helix protein that is difficult for the body to absorb. Through controlled enzymatic hydrolysis, the collagen is broken into short-chain peptides. These low-molecular-weight peptides (typically 2,000–5,000 Da for standard collagen peptides; fish collagen tripeptide can be even lower) are water-soluble and can be absorbed through the intestinal wall into the bloodstream. Once absorbed, they act as signaling molecules that stimulate fibroblasts to produce new collagen and extracellular matrix components. For a Dr. Biocare Collagen Peptide Multivitamin Mineral Supplement, the peptide fraction provides the structural building blocks, while the vitamins (like Vitamin C) and minerals (like Zinc) serve as co-factors for collagen synthesis. This synergy is why multi-nutrient formulations are popular in the beauty-from-within and joint health segments.
When sourcing collagen peptide for a formulation like Dr. Biocare, buyers need to verify specific parameters. Below is a table of typical industry ranges for collagen peptides used in nutraceutical applications. Note: these are generic ranges; final values should be confirmed per Certificate of Analysis (COA) or sample.
| Parameter | Typical Range (Industry Standard) | Notes for Buyers |
|---|---|---|
| Molecular Weight | 2,000–5,000 Da (fish often lower) | Lower MW generally means faster absorption |
| Protein Content | ≥90% | High protein ensures potency |
| Solubility | ≥98% in cold water | Critical for mixing and mouthfeel |
| Odor / Taste | Low to neutral | Fishy smell indicates poor processing |
| Heavy Metals | Complies with USP/EP limits | In-house lab testing recommended |
| Mesh Size | 40–80 mesh (typical) | Affects dissolution rate |
*Typical industry range; final values per COA / sample.

Q: What is the difference between collagen peptide and gelatin for a supplement like Dr. Biocare?
A: Collagen peptide is fully hydrolyzed, soluble in cold water, and has a molecular weight of 2,000–5,000 Da, making it ideal for powdered drinks and capsules. Gelatin is partially hydrolyzed, requires warm water to dissolve, and has higher bloom strength (50–300 g), used primarily for gummies and softgels. Choose based on your final product form.
Q: How do I ensure the collagen peptide has low fishy odor?
A: Low odor is a quality marker. It depends on the raw material freshness and the enzymatic hydrolysis process. Request a sensory evaluation sample from your supplier. Q: How do I compare collagen peptide suppliers on quality?
A: Request a COA for every batch. Key parameters: molecular weight distribution, protein content (≥90%), solubility (≥98%), heavy metals (within USP limits), and microbiological counts.
